The Ancient Magus’ Bride (Mahou Tsukai no Yome) will start airing on 8 October 2017 and the anime full of fantasy and magic has revealed a third key visual and its third trailer. The trailer is as fantastic as the story description sounds.
The anime introduced a new character!
Even though he looks like a child, he is called ‘Wandering Jew’ among magicians. Nobody knows something about his interests or goals. He acts only to serve himself.

Atsumi Tanezaki as Chise Hatori
Ryota Takeuchi as Elias Ainsworth
Kaido Yuko as Angelica Varley
Toshiyuki Morikawa as Simon Kalm
Junichi Suwabe as Seth Moel
Daisuke Namikawa as Lindel
Satoshi hino as Michael Renfred
Mutsumi Tamura as Alice
Koki Uchiyama as Ruth
Aya Endo as Silver
Sayaka Ohara as Titania
Original work: Kore Yamazaki
Series Composition/Director: Norihiro Naganuma
Screenplay: Aya Takaha
Character design: Hirotaka Kato
Music: Junichi Matsumoto
Music production: Flying Dog
Animation studio: WIT STUDIO
